Protecting Your Polar Recovery Tub with the Rain Repellant Thermo Lid

A cold plunge or ice bath is only useful if the setup stays practical in real outdoor conditions. A fitted cover or rain repellant thermo lid can help protect the tub from leaves, rain, insects, sunlight and heat gain. It may also reduce how often you need to top up ice or run a chiller unit.

For buyers in gardens, patios, rental cabins or glamping spaces, this is not a small detail. A tub that looks good on day one can become annoying if the water is constantly exposed to debris, sunlight and temperature swings.

Before buying, check whether the cover is included, whether it is insulated, how easy it is to remove, and whether it fits securely in windy or wet weather.

Using a Floating Thermometer and Chiller Without Guesswork

polar recovery

A floating thermometer is a simple accessory, but it can be useful if you are using ice instead of a chiller. It helps you see whether the water is actually cold enough for your preferred routine instead of guessing by feel.

A chiller is the more convenient route if you want repeatable temperatures without buying bags of ice. For larger tubs, warmer outdoor spaces or frequent use, a stronger chiller may be worth considering. For occasional use, manual ice may be enough.

Peace of Mind: Customer Reviews, Warranty and What to Verify

polar general 3

A warranty can reduce buyer risk, but it should not be treated as proof that a product is maintenance-free or suitable for every use case. Polar Recovery materials commonly emphasize practical outdoor use, portability and accessible setup, but buyers should still verify exactly what is covered before purchasing.

Check the warranty length, what parts are included, whether commercial use is covered, how claims are handled, and whether return shipping or replacement parts create extra costs. This matters especially for chillers, tubs, covers and sauna components because outdoor recovery equipment is exposed to water, temperature changes, UV light and regular handling.

Customer reviews can be helpful, but they do not replace careful product checking. Look for comments about setup, leaks, chiller performance, cover quality, cleaning, delivery, and customer support. Avoid judging the product only by marketing photos or extreme recovery claims.

Renu Therapy vs Polar Recovery: Premium Hard-Shell vs Modular Setup

polar general 4

Renu Therapy and Polar Recovery serve different buyers. Renu Therapy is closer to the premium hard-shell category: higher price, heavier build, stronger design presence and a more permanent home recovery setup. Polar Recovery is more modular and flexible, with separate tubs, chillers, saunas, covers and hot tub options.

Renu Therapy may make more sense if you want a luxury cold plunge that becomes a permanent feature in a home gym, patio or dedicated recovery space. Polar Recovery may make more sense if you want to build your setup in stages: tub first, chiller later, sauna separately, or a wood-fired hot tub for a garden.

The trade-off is simple. Premium hard-shell systems usually look better and feel more permanent, but they cost more and are harder to move. Modular systems are easier to configure and may be more accessible, but buyers need to pay closer attention to setup, water care, insulation and long-term durability.

Polar Recovery for Airbnb, Glamping and Hospitality: Worth Considering?

polar general 5

Polar Recovery may be relevant for Airbnb hosts, glamping cabins, boutique stays and small wellness businesses because cold plunge and sauna setups are visually strong amenities. They can help a listing stand out, especially in outdoor or nature-focused properties.

But this is not a guaranteed revenue upgrade. Property owners need to think like operators, not wellness influencers. Guest safety rules, cleaning time, water care, drainage, insurance, supervision, local regulations and replacement parts matter more than how good the setup looks in photos.

For hospitality use, start small and verify the workflow. A tub and cover may be easier to manage than a full contrast therapy suite. A chiller may reduce ice logistics but adds mechanical maintenance. A wood-fired hot tub can feel premium but requires fuel, heating time and clear guest instructions.

Operational Logistics: Maintaining Your Recovery Tub and Polar Recovery Sauna

Maintenance is where many recovery setups either succeed or become annoying. Cold plunges, ice baths, chillers, saunas and hot tubs all need cleaning, safe setup and basic inspection.

For cold tubs, check water clarity, remove debris, clean the waterline, use the cover, and follow the brand’s guidance for water care. If you use a chiller, check filter access, hose connections, flow, noise and whether the unit can handle your outdoor climate.

For saunas and wood-fired hot tubs, think about heat source, ventilation, surface protection, fuel storage, drainage and safe guest instructions. If the setup is for a rental or hospitality property, create a simple checklist for cleaners or staff so the same process is followed every time.

Practical Use: Keep Heat and Cold Routines Conservative

Most buyers do not need advanced protocols. The safer approach is to start conservatively, keep sessions short, avoid extreme temperatures at first, and pay attention to how the body responds.

Cold plunges, saunas and hot tubs can all place stress on the cardiovascular system. Avoid combining intense heat and intense cold if you feel dizzy, unwell, dehydrated, overheated, or unsure.

For most home users, the goal should not be extreme adaptation. The goal is a setup that is safe, repeatable, clean, and easy enough to use consistently.
